5-Carboxycytosine-13C,15N2 is doubly labeled 5-Carboxycytosine (C177975). Cytosine derivatives, such as 5-Carboxylcytosine, are involved with a wide variety of biological functions including cytosine methylation, gene expression, genome stability, and chromatin modification. In addition, 5-Carboxylcytosine interacts with the RNA polymerase II elongation complex that can influence the pluripotent states during early embryonic development.
